| * Allow PCI config space syscalls to be used by 64-bit processes.Paul Mackerras2005-09-093-57/+64
| | | | | | | | | | | | | | | | | | | | The pciconfig_iobase, pciconfig_read and pciconfig_write system calls were only implemented for 32-bit processes; for 64-bit processes they returned an ENOSYS error. This allows them to be used by 64-bit processes as well. The X server uses pciconfig_iobase at least, and this change is necessary to allow a 64-bit X server to work on my G5. | * [PATCH] PPC64: large INITRD causes kernel not to bootMark Bellon2005-09-091-5/+26
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| In PPC64 there are number of problems in arch/ppc64/boot/main.c that prevent a kernel from making use of a large (greater than ~16MB) INITRD. This is 64 bit architecture and really large INITRD images should be possible. Simply put the existing code has a fixed reservation (claim) address and once the kernel plus initrd image are large enough to pass this address all sorts of bad things occur. The fix is the dynamically establish the first claim address above the loaded kernel plus initrd (plus some "padding" and rounding). If PROG_START is defined this will be used as the minimum safe address - currently known to be 0x01400000 for the firmwares tested so far. | * [PATCH] ppc64: fix IPI on bpa_iicArnd Bergmann2005-09-091-7/+21
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This fixes a severe bug in the bpa_iic driver that caused all sorts of problems. We had been using incorrect priority values for inter processor interrupts, which resulted in always doing CALL_FUNCTION instead of RESCHEDULE or DEBUGGER_BREAK. The symptoms cured by this patch include bad performance on SMP systems spurious kernel panics in the IPI code. | * | [IA64] make exception handler in copy_user more robustChen, Kenneth W2005-09-071-0/+3
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The exception handler in copy user always expects fault occurs only on user space address and the fall back recovery code is written with that very assumption in mind. Recent source code inspection revealed that while it worked splendid and to the expectation under normal circumstances, It broke down under unexpected condition where some address calculation might go outside the legal address range the original copy_user was called for. This patch is to make copy_user exception handler more robust and to prevent potential memory corruption. | * | | [CPUFREQ] speedstep-centrino: skip extract_clock logic for acpi based centrinoVenkatesh Pallipadi2005-08-311-7/+7
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| speedstep_centrino.c:extract_clock() assumes the bus speed of 100MHz, which is not true with latest laptops. Due to this assumption and due to the encoded frequency check during initialization, speedstep-centrino driver fails even on systems that has proper ACPI information to do the P-state transition. The change below moves the centrino-speedstep detection to be used only when table based P-state transition is done. For ACPI based P-state transition, we skip the centrino_cpu identification, and as a result we don't use the bus speed assumption in extract_clock. This change makes speedstep-centrino work on Pentium-M based systems, which have more than 100MHz bus speed. | * | | | [PATCH] PCI: restore BAR values after D3hot->D0 for devices that need itJohn W. Linville2005-09-081-0/+6
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Some PCI devices (e.g. 3c905B, 3c556B) lose all configuration (including BARs) when transitioning from D3hot->D0. This leaves such a device in an inaccessible state. The patch below causes the BARs to be restored when enabling such a device, so that its driver will be able to access it. The patch also adds pci_restore_bars as a new global symbol, and adds a correpsonding EXPORT_SYMBOL_GPL for that. Some firmware (e.g. Thinkpad T21) leaves devices in D3hot after a (re)boot. Most drivers call pci_enable_device very early, so devices left in D3hot that lose configuration during the D3hot->D0 transition will be inaccessible to their drivers. Drivers could be modified to account for this, but it would be difficult to know which drivers need modification. This is especially true since often many devices are covered by the same driver. It likely would be necessary to replicate code across dozens of drivers. The patch below should trigger only when transitioning from D3hot->D0 (or at boot), and only for devices that have the "no soft reset" bit cleared in the PM control register. I believe it is safe to include this patch as part of the PCI infrastructure. The cleanest implementation of pci_restore_bars was to call pci_update_resource. Unfortunately, that does not currently exist for the sparc64 architecture. The patch below includes a null implemenation of pci_update_resource for sparc64. Some have expressed interest in making general use of the the pci_restore_bars function, so that has been exported to GPL licensed modules. Signed-off-by: John W. | * | | | [SPARC64]: Inline membar()'s again.David S. Miller2005-09-083-83/+1
| |/ / / |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Since GCC has to emit a call and a delay slot to the out-of-line "membar" routines in arch/sparc64/lib/mb.S it is much better to just do the necessary predicted branch inline instead as: ba,pt %xcc, 1f membar #whatever 1: instead of the current: call membar_foo dslot because this way GCC is not required to allocate a stack frame if the function can be a leaf function. This also makes this bug fix easier to backport to 2.4.x Signed-off-by: David S. Miller <davem@davemloft.net>
